Output 94e3d8f6275aa62a108da7997e2fe1d6508ca2ca7dbbb489039aea1cea345bef:8

value
1114384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c0bf7f784b008e4946851a8b4bc99cfb628d8a0 OP_EQUAL
address
35huzaWm7coGfHaDYwhXHc3aZBSNkEjX3S
transaction
94e3d8f6275aa62a108da7997e2fe1d6508ca2ca7dbbb489039aea1cea345bef
spent
true